Newcastle United captain Jamaal Lascelles has warned the Championship there is more to come from them this season, speaking to the Chronicle.
The Magpies continued their winning form on Saturday as they secured a win over Brighton & Hove Albion, who were managed by former Newcastle boss Chris Hughton.
The victory was their third on the bounce as they have come back from losing their first two games of the season.

The result took Newcastle up to fourth in the table and just four points behind surprise leaders Huddersfield Town.
It was an impressive performance from Rafa Benitez’s side, but Lascelles has warned that there is even more to come from them.
“We are only going to get better,” he told the Chronicle. “We were missing two of our best players in Mitro (Aleksandar Mitrovic) and Dwight Gayle so if we are beating Brighton like that, we know there is more to offer.”

While Lascelles says there is more to come from them moving forward, Benitez will certainly be pleased by what he has seen so far.
Those first two defeats would have been worrying, but his side has bounced back well and now looks like a team capable of challenging at the top half of the table.
